Seared Salmon Fillet with Roasted Asparagus and Cauliflower Mash
Enjoy a perfectly seared salmon fillet paired with roasted asparagus and a creamy cauliflower mash. This dish combines the rich, buttery flavor of salmon with the earthiness of roasted vegetables, finished with a silky, olive oil-infused mash for a dinner that’s both satisfying and nutritious.
INGREDIENTS
5 oz Salmon Fillet
1 cup Asparagus
1 cup Cauliflower
1 tbsp Olive Oil (for mash)
1 tsp Olive Oil (for searing)
PREPARATION
Season the salmon fillet with salt and pepper.
Heat 1 teaspoon of olive oil in a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. Sear the salmon fillet for about 3 minutes per side, or until the exterior is crispy and the fish is just cooked through.
Preheat your oven to 400°F. Meanwhile, toss the asparagus with a pinch of salt and pepper. Spread them on a baking sheet and roast for 10-12 minutes until tender and lightly charred.
For the cauliflower mash, cut the cauliflower into florets and boil in lightly salted water until tender (about 8-10 minutes). Drain well. Transfer the cauliflower to a bowl and mash with 1 tablespoon of olive oil, salt, and pepper until smooth.
Plate the seared salmon alongside the roasted asparagus and a generous serving of cauliflower mash. Serve immediately and enjoy your balanced dinner.
